< Amsal 21 >

1 TUHAN berkuasa mengarahkan hati raja sesuai kehendak-Nya, seperti petani mengatur arah pengairan di sawahnya.
Yahweh controls what kings do [MTY] [like] he controls how streams flow; he causes kings to do just what he wants them to do.
2 Setiap orang menganggap pilihan hidupnya baik, tetapi TUHANlah yang mengetahui dan menilai maksud hatinya.
People always think that what they do is right, but Yahweh judges our (motives/reasons [for doing things)] [MTY].
3 TUHAN lebih berkenan pada cara hidup yang adil dan benar daripada kurban persembahan.
Doing what is right and fair is more acceptable to Yahweh than [bringing] sacrifices [to him].
4 Sombong dan suka merendahkan orang lain— kedua sifat itu selalu membawa orang ke dalam kejahatan.
Being proud and arrogant [DOU] is [like] a lamp [MTY] [that guides] wicked people; being proud and arrogant characterizes (wicked people’s whole behavior/everything that wicked people do).
5 Rencana yang baik disertai kerja keras menghasilkan keuntungan. Bertindak terburu-buru tanpa pikir panjang menghasilkan kemiskinan.
People who plan carefully will surely have plenty [of what they need]; those who act too quickly [to become rich] will become poor.
6 Kekayaan yang diperoleh dengan tidak jujur akan cepat menguap dan mengantarkan pemiliknya pada kebinasaan.
Money that people acquire [by cheating others] by lying [MTY] to them will soon disappear [like] a mist, and doing that will [soon] lead to their death.
7 Orang jahat tidak mau berbuat benar, dan kelakuan jahat mereka kelak menghancurkan dirinya sendiri.
Wicked [people] refuse to do what is right/just, but they will be ruined because of the violent things [PRS] that they do.
8 Orang yang menyembunyikan dosa hidup berliku-liku, tetapi orang yang jujur hidupnya lurus dan benar.
Guilty [people continually do what is evil; it is as though] [MET] they are walking on a crooked road; but righteous/innocent people [always] do what is right.
9 Lebih baik hidup sendirian di kamar yang sempit daripada tinggal di rumah besar bersama istri yang suka bertengkar.
It is better to live in the corner of an attic/housetop [by yourself] than to live inside the house with a wife who is always nagging.
10 Orang jahat selalu mencari kesempatan untuk menyakiti dan tak punya belas kasihan kepada siapa pun, bahkan temannya sendiri.
Wicked [people] [SYN] are always wanting [to do what is] evil; they never act mercifully toward anyone.
11 Bila orang yang suka menghina dihajar, maka orang yang tak berpengalaman dapat mengambil pelajaran. Bila orang bijak ditegur, dia akan semakin bijak.
When those who ridicule [others] are punished, [even] those who do not have good sense [see that, and] they become wise, and when those who are wise are taught, they become wiser.
12 Allah Yang Mahaadil mengetahui segalanya, bahkan yang paling tersembunyi dalam kehidupan orang jahat, dan Dia akan menghancurkan mereka.
[God], the one [who is completely] righteous, knows [what happens inside] the houses of wicked [people], and [he will cause] those people to be completely ruined/destroyed.
13 Siapa yang tidak mau mendengar seruan orang miskin, kelak dia sendiri tidak akan didengar pada waktu berteriak minta tolong.
There are people who refuse to listen when poor people cry out [for help]; [but some day] they themselves will cry out [for help], and no one will hear them.
14 Amarah seseorang dapat diredakan dengan memberi hadiah kepadanya secara empat mata.
When someone is angry [with you], if you secretly give him a gift, he will stop being angry.
15 Ketika keadilan ditegakkan, orang benar bersukacita, tetapi orang jahat ketakutan.
Good/Righteous [people] are happy when they [see others do] what is just/fair, but those who do what is evil are terrified [when they think about what may happen to them].
16 Orang yang tidak menggunakan akal sehatnya akan segera terkumpul bersama orang-orang bebal lain yang sudah lebih dulu mati!
Those who stop behaving like those who have good sense behave will [soon] discover that they have gone to the place where dead people are.
17 Orang yang senang berfoya-foya akan jatuh miskin. Orang yang suka mabuk-mabukan dan bermewah-mewah tidak akan pernah kaya.
Those who spend their money to buy (things that give them pleasure/things that cause them to feel happy) will become poor; those who love [to spend money to buy] wine and nice/fancy food [MTY] will never become rich.
18 Karena TUHAN menjaga orang jujur, kejahatan yang direncanakan orang jahat kepada orang jujur justru menimpa dirinya sendiri.
Wicked [people] bring on themselves the sufferings that they were trying to cause righteous [people] to experience [DOU].
19 Lebih baik hidup sendirian di padang belantara daripada tinggal di rumah bersama istri yang suka bertengkar dan mengomel.
It is better to live [alone] in a desert than [to live] with a wife who is [always] nagging and complaining.
20 Orang yang bijak mengatur persediaan harta dan makanan di rumahnya, tetapi orang bodoh tidak mengendalikan diri dan menghabiskan segala miliknya.
Wise people have many valuable things in their houses, but foolish people [quickly] spend/waste [all their money].
21 Senantiasa lakukanlah apa yang benar dan baik bagi sesama, maka engkau akan panjang umur, hidup sejahtera, dan dihormati.
Those who [always] try to act in a fair and kind way [toward others] will live [a long time] and be honored/respected.
22 Dengan kebijaksanaannya, orang bijak sanggup merebut kota orang-orang kuat dan meruntuhkan benteng pertahanan yang mereka andalkan.
A wise army commander [helps his troops] climb over a wall [to attack] a city that is defended by a strong army, with the result that they are able to (get over/destroy) the high walls that their enemies trusted [would protect them].
23 Orang yang berbicara dengan hati-hati menjauhkan dirinya dari masalah.
Those who are very careful about what they say [MTY] are [able to] avoid trouble.
24 Orang yang angkuh, tinggi hati, besar mulut, dan selalu meremehkan orang, panggillah dia si sombong.
Those who make fun of [everything that is good] are proud and conceited [DOU]; they [always] act in an inconsiderate way [toward others].
25 Keinginan si pemalas terbawa sampai mati sebab dia tidak mau bekerja.
Lazy people, who refuse to work, [will] die [of hunger] because they [SYN] do not earn [money to buy food].
26 Orang yang serakah selalu menginginkan lebih untuk dirinya sendiri, tetapi orang benar suka memberi dengan limpah.
All during the day [wicked people] desire to obtain things, but righteous [people] have plenty, [with the result that] they [are able to] give things generously to others.
27 TUHAN jijik melihat kurban dari orang yang jahat, apalagi jika dipersembahkan dengan maksud jahat.
[Yahweh] detests the sacrifices that wicked [people] offer [to him]; [but he] detests it even more when they [think that they will escape being punished for] their evil deeds because of the sacrifices that they bring.
28 Saksi yang berdusta akan dibinasakan, tetapi perkataan dari saksi yang dapat dipercaya akan diperhatikan dan diingat.
Those who tell lies in court will be punished; no one stops/silences witnesses who say what is truthful/reliable.
29 Orang jahat berlagak berani, tetapi orang jujur mengatur langkahnya dengan benar.
Wicked people pretend [that they know everything], but righteous people think carefully about [what will happen because of] what they do.
30 Tidak ada kebijaksanaan, pengertian, dan rancangan manusia yang sanggup melebihi hikmat TUHAN.
[Thinking that we are] wise, and that we understand many things, and that we have good insight, does not help us if Yahweh is (acting against/not pleased with) us.
31 Pasukan raja mempersiapkan semua kuda dan kereta untuk bertempur, tetapi TUHANlah yang menentukan kemenangan.
We [can] get horses ready to fight in a battle, but Yahweh is the one who enables us to (win victories/defeat our enemies).
